Uniform Types

  • No. 1 Service Dress uniform consists of:

    • No. 1 SD Airman/woman hat (Cadets in the ATC wear the ATC cap badge/Cadets in the CCF wear the RAF cap badge)
    • No. 1 SD Jacket
    • Gloves (black for SNCO's and brown for WO's)
    • Long-sleeved Wedgewood shirt
    • Black tie
    • Trousers (female Cadets are entitled to wear skirts (with tights) or trousers)
    • Parade shoes

    The No. 1 SD uniform is worn for formal events and parades, such as Remembrance Parades. Worn by Officers and Staff WO/SNCO's; select Cadets may be given permission to wear No.1 uniform. 

  • No. 2 (Full) Service Working Dress (No. 2 (Full) SD)

    Uniform:
    • Beret
    • Jumper
    • Brassard (and rank slides/lanyard where appropriate)
    • Long-sleeved Wedgewood shirt
    • Black tie
    • Belt
    • Trousers/skirt (with tights)
    • Parade shoes
    Points to Note: 
    • Brassard (and rank slides/lanyard where appropriate) are always on the outside of the jumper
    • The tie should have a Windsor knot
    • Belts are worn underneath the jumper
    • White belts may be worn, when directed, outside the jumper
    • Female Cadets can choose between skirts or slacks
    • If tights are worn, they should be 15 Denier (nearly black)
    • If trousers are worn, black socks should be worn
  • No. 2A Service Working Dress (No. 2A SD)

    Uniform:
    • Beret
    • Brassard (and rank slides/lanyard where appropriate)
    • Long-sleeved Wedgewood shirt
    • Black tie
    • Belt
    • Trousers/skirt (with tights)
    • Parade shoes
    Points to Note: 
    • The tie should have a Windsor knot
    • Stable belts or standard issue grey belts should be worn
    • White belts may be worn, when directed
    • Female Cadets can choose between skirts or slacks
    • If tights are worn, they should be 15 Denier (nearly black)
    • If trousers are worn, black socks should be worn
  • No. 2B Service Working Dress (No. 2B SD)

    Uniform:

    • Peak hat, beret or side cap
    • Short-sleeved Wedgewood shirt
    • Trousers (female staff are entitled to wear skirts (with tights) or trousers)
    • Parade shoes

    Uniform Notes:

    • A tie is never worn with this uniform
    • Adult Staff ONLY
  • No. 2C Service Working Dress (No. 2C SD) 

    Uniform (Cadets Only): 
    • Beret
    • Jumper
    • Brassard (and rank slides/lanyard where appropriate)
    • Working Blues shirt
    • Belt
    • Trousers/skirt (with tights)
    • Parade shoes
    Points to Note: 
    • Brassard (and rank slides/lanyard where appropriate) are always on the outside of the jumper
    • Jumpers may be worn with this uniform
    • Sleeves can be rolled up or down 
    • Belts are worn underneath the jumper
    • Female Cadets can choose between skirts or slacks
    • If tights are worn, they should be 15 Denier (nearly black)
    • If trousers are worn, black socks should be worn
  • No. 3 Service Dress - Operational (No. 3 SD)

    Uniform:
    • Beret
    • Smock
    • Shirt
    • T-shirt
    • Trousers
    • Boots
    MTP
    (illustrations not available in MTP)

    Points to Note: 
    • T-shirt colour should match/be similar to the MTP colours, depending on the style worn
    • Stable belts may be worn with this uniform, except when ‘in the field’
    • Shirt sleeves can be worn up or down (always down in the field)
    • Air Cadet patch is to be worn on the right arm
    • Black or Brown Boots
  • No. 3A Service Dress - Public Military Engagement (No. 3A SD)

    Uniform:
    • Headdress (Beret or Baseball hat)
    • Shirt (polo or t-shirt style)
    • Belt
    • Trousers
    • Boots
    • Smock
    Points to Note:
      • Permission from Region HQ must be obtained before this uniform is worn. ​
      • Shirts (polo or t-shirt style) and baseball hats must confirm to the colour, logo and design specifications
      • During inclement weather, a smock with rank insignia may be worn but all personnel are to be attired in the same fashion. Berets are to be worn with outer wear.

    Awaiting image illustration, but photos copied from AP1358C (V3.0, Dec18), Page 61:

  • No. 4 Service Dress - Mess Dress (No. 4 SD) 

    Uniform:
    • No. 1 SD jacket (Staff only)
    • Marcella white shirt 
    • Black bow tie
    • Trousers (female Cadets are entitled to wear skirts (with tights) or trousers
    • Parade shoes
    Points to Note: 
    • No. 4 SD uniform is worn for formal evening events
    • Stable belts can be worn with this uniform
  • No. 14 Dress

    Uniform:
    • Flight suit
    • T-shirt
    • Beret
    • Boots
    • Flight suit patches (inc. name badges)
    Points to Note: 
    • No. 14 Dress is the flying clothing worn by pilots, instructors (including Flight Staff Cadets) and Cadets at AEF/VGS
    • Qualified Aerospace Instructor cadets are also authorised to wear this uniform
    • Typically, the No. 2C SD or No. 3 SD is worn underneath the No. 14 Dress when worn by Cadets for AEF/VGS. When worn by instructors/staff, a pair of trousers and an appropriate t-shirt is usually worn
  • Coveralls (Not routinely issued to Cadets)
    Coveralls are usually worn by new Cadets that have not been given their uniforms yet, or when blue uniforms have to be covered up
